Glomerular Filtration Membrane / Barrier1) Endothelial cells layer of the capil ary,
2) Basement membrane and
--- Content provided by FirstRanker.com ---
3) Epithelial cells (podocytes) ? surrounding outer surface of cp
basement membrane.
Glomerular Filtration Barrier ? Cp Endothelial layer
--- Content provided by FirstRanker.com ---
The capillary endothelium has thousands of small holes called
fenestrae
--- Content provided by FirstRanker.com ---
But loaded with negative charged glycoproteinsGlomerular Filtration Barrier - basement membrane
The surrounding basement membrane - is a porous meshwork of
--- Content provided by FirstRanker.com ---
proteins ? contain type IV collagen and proteoglycan fibrillae.
Glomerular Filtration Barrier ? Podocytes Layer
The long finger like processes of the podocytes interdigitate to
--- Content provided by FirstRanker.com ---
cover the basement membrane and are separated by apparent
gaps called filtration slits.
--- Content provided by FirstRanker.com ---
Glomerular Filtration Barrier ? Podocytes LayerGFB restricts the filtration of substances on the basis of
Size & Electrical charges
